Transaction e0860ca18b4e7a1bb4530671ff1992306c7480424821765edb5948a05ff16fdd
1 Input
1 Output
-
e0860ca18b4e7a1bb4530671ff1992306c7480424821765edb5948a05ff16fdd:0
- value
- 18041
- script pubkey
- OP_0 OP_PUSHBYTES_20 8863d1c77ac4bf89444c3eb0f619390d5b8a3f59
- address
- bc1q3p3ar3m6cjlcj3zv86c0vxfep4dc506elqy3e9